    Silver Alert Issued for Missing 69-Year-Old Woman in Seguin, Texas

    Authorities Seek Public Assistance

    The Texas Department of Public Safety has activated a Silver Alert for a 69-year-old woman, Bernice Dedek, who has been reported missing in Seguin, Texas. Dedek was last seen on Thursday afternoon at approximately 2 p.m. in the vicinity of the 700 block of Stratton Street. Officials are concerned for her safety as the search continues.

    Description and Vehicle Information

    Bernice Dedek is described as a white female standing 5 feet 7 inches tall, weighing approximately 190 pounds. She has red or auburn hair coupled with green eyes. At the time of her disappearance, she was wearing a purple shirt and black shorts, making her identifiable to potential witnesses.

    Dedek was last known to be traveling in a white 2012 Nissan Versa, which bears Texas license plate number SXT4893. Authorities stress that anyone who may have seen her should exercise caution and contact law enforcement immediately.
